CasinoLab‘s Compatibility with Different Devices

As mobile gaming becomes increasingly popular, evaluating a casino’s compatibility with various devices is crucial for players who enjoy gaming on the go. CasinoLab is one such platform that promises a seamless experience across different devices. This article critically assesses CasinoLab’s mobile UX, focusing on app quality, responsiveness, and the touch interface.

The Verdict

CasinoLab delivers a commendable mobile experience with its user-friendly interface and solid game selection. However, some drawbacks, including limited app availability and occasional performance hiccups, warrant attention. Overall, players can expect a satisfactory experience, especially when accessing through web browsers.

The Good

  • Responsive Design: CasinoLab’s website is optimised for mobile devices, ensuring that players can access it seamlessly across smartphones and tablets.
  • Game Variety: The platform offers over 1,000 games, including slots, table games, and live dealer options from top providers like NetEnt and Evolution Gaming.
  • Touch Interface: The touch interface is intuitive, allowing for easy navigation. Buttons are well-sized, reducing the likelihood of misclicks, which is essential for mobile play.
  • Quick Load Times: Games load swiftly, with minimal lag, enabling players to jump straight into action without unnecessary delays.
  • Mobile-Specific Promotions: CasinoLab occasionally offers exclusive promotions for mobile users, enhancing the overall gaming experience.

The Bad

  • Limited App Availability: Currently, CasinoLab does not offer a dedicated mobile app for iOS or Android users, which may deter some players who prefer app-based gaming.
  • Occasional Performance Issues: While generally responsive, some users have reported occasional lags or crashes during gameplay, particularly during peak times.
  • Browser Dependency: The reliance on a mobile browser can lead to discrepancies in performance, making the experience less consistent compared to dedicated apps.

The Ugly

  • Compatibility Issues: Certain games may not function optimally on older devices or less popular browsers, leading to a frustrating experience for some players.
  • Limited Payment Options: Mobile users may find fewer payment methods available, with certain options only accessible via desktop.
  • Navigation Challenges: While the interface is generally user-friendly, some players have noted that accessing specific features, like the customer support section, can be cumbersome on smaller screens.
